Oh Mamma Mia! Set Me Free!

My husband and I were so privileged to receive tickets to the OC Performing Arts musical of Mamma Mia last night. What an amazing, energizing and delightful performance! Many of us couldn’t help but sing along to the music of Abba.

Before the musical, my husband leaned over and whispered, “Do you know what this is about?” I replied, “I think it’s about a daughter getting married. I can’t quite remember. It’s been a long time since I saw the movie.” Boy, I was a bit off! Yes, a wedding does occur but the story line is really about a young woman who believes knowing the identity of her father would bring clarity to her own existence. As the story unfolds we see the mother (played by Kaye Tuckerman-Matrix Reloaded) is really the one who discovers who she is. She’s a misunderstood tough woman who lived the past twenty years with bitterness from a misunderstood lost love.  Not only do we see a grown woman and single parent haunted by her mistakes but we see she’s never experienced a life of joy or freedom from her past.

I’m sure many of us could relate to her…wanting the secret to be revealed, but afraid of the outcome yet knowing the burden of a lie is sometimes too heavy to bear.  Through a series of actions by her daughter, the secret comes out and we see (1) how relieved she is, (2) her family and friends are more understanding than she ever imagined, and (3) she is now free from the lie to love and live joyfully like she was intended!

My mind kept thinking back to the verse: And you shall know the truth, and the truth shall set you free. John 8:32 Our God is a loving God, so much we cannot phantom His love for us. Like a father, He yearns for us to come to Him and reveal the truth of our sin so He can set us free from it. His dearly beloved Son sacrificed His life to wipe away our sins so we can be free to live and love the way He created us to be. Sin will always separate us from Him and the ones we love.  What’s keeping you from being free?
